Akushu.

S/he is sick.

Nin, apu tshekuan itian.

I'm fine, there's nothing wrong.

Nitshiuen, nika ashteieshkushin.

I'm going home, I'm going to rest.

Kuei nuitsheuakan!

Hello my friend!

Nasht apu minupanit.

S/he is not doing well at all.

Tapue a?

Really?

Iame uenapissish!

See you soon!

Apu shukᵘ minupanit.

S/he is not doing very well.

Eukuan miam, niaut!

That's good, goodbye!

Tan eshpanit tshuitsheuakan?

How is your friend?

Ekᵘ tshin, tan etin?

And you, what's the matter?

Tan etit?

What's wrong with her/him?
